You are here: Home / Blog / posts / Programming Magic / Create scripts for source control

Create scripts for source control

by jsylvest — published Dec 09, 2010 09:45 PM, last modified Jan 28, 2014 12:01 PM
When creating SQL scripts for source control, date time stamps make it difficult to see exactly what changed between versions.

Steps to create scripts to to create your database

1) Right click your database and choose Tasks->Generate Scripts...

Generate Scripts Menu

2) On the Choose Objects step, don't choose "Script entire database and all database objects" as this contains roles and other things we don't want. Instead choose "Select specific database objects". typically Tables, Views, and stored procedures.

Choose Objects

3) Choose where to save the script. Typically the query window is picked so it can be copied and pasted into a script file for source control.

4) Click on the Advanced button.

Advanced Button

5) Typically most values are not changed. To prevent the date time stamp, set "Include Descriptive Headers" to False

No Headers Choice

6) Press OK on the Advanced Scripting Options screen.

7) Press Next >, Next>, Finish

 

When:

Where:

Contact